Is 912 649 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 912 649 is about 955.327.

Thus, the square root of 912 649 is not an integer, and therefore 912 649 is not a square number.

Anyway, 912 649 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 912 649?

The square of a number (here 912 649) is the result of the product of this number (912 649) by itself (i.e., 912 649 × 912 649); the square of 912 649 is sometimes called "raising 912 649 to the power 2", or "912 649 squared".

The square of 912 649 is 832 928 197 201 because 912 649 × 912 649 = 912 6492 = 832 928 197 201.

As a consequence, 912 649 is the square root of 832 928 197 201.
